IFI Module-Specific Notes

Addresses

Addresses are broken out by address type, and you can apply fields to the type of address that you’re importing, e.g. “Home”. A few fields – phone and e-mail – can be entered without specifying an address type. With these, IFI will try to find the best address to update, and if it can’t find one, it will create a “Home” address. Phone number fields do not have to be formatted, and if a default phone format has been set up, IFI will use that.

The “Bad phone number” and “Bad e-mail address” fields are special. These are used to mark a phone number or e-mail address as bad, and they work across all address types. To mark a phone number or e-mail address as not bad, just import that value into an appropriate field and VSys will remove the “Bad” flag.

IFI always updates or creates addresses by type, it never deletes them, so there is no “Action” field.

Availability

Action can hold “Append”, “A”, “Overwrite”, “O”, “Delete”, or “D”. These fields are not case-sensitive, and indicate what IFI should do for this person's availability. Specifying “Append” will add any given availability in the file to the person's existing availability. "Overwrite" deletes any existing availability and replaces it with the new records, but only does so if one or more new records are given in the import file. "Delete" imports any new records and deletes all of the person's existing availability regardless of whether new records are being added.

Certifications

Certifications include background check requests and results.

Action can hold “Create”, “C”, “Update”, “U”, “Update/create”, “*”, “Delete”, or “d”. These fields are not case-sensitive, and indicate what IFI should do for this type of certification. Specifying “Create” will always make a new certification with this data, unless the person is not allowed to have more than one of this type of certification, in which case it will fail. “Update” will only update an existing certification of this type, it will fail if the person does not have one. “Update/create” will update an existing one if present, otherwise it will make a new one. “Delete” will delete an existing certification if present, and fail if the person does not have one. In the case of “Delete”, if more than one is present, IFI will work with the one which matches the effective date specified, if provided, otherwise it will work with the first one it finds.

You can import multiple types of certifications, each with a different action, since each action is associated with a specific type of certification.

General

When importing a record which involves a location, you can specify the location using either its hierarchical value, e.g. "Troy.RPI.Union.Room 308" or by its friendly description, "RPI Union room 308" as designated in the location's Full description field.

Interviews

Interviews are used for intake screening, evaluations, or even satisfaction surveys.

Action can hold “Create”, “C”, “Update”, “U”, “Update/create”, “*”, “Delete”, or “d”. These fields are not case-sensitive, and indicate what IFI should do for this type of interview. Specifying “Create” will always make a new interview with this data. “Update” will only update an existing interview of this type for the selected interviewee. If more than one of that type of interview exists, VSys will attempt to match on the interview date. “Update/create” will update an existing one if present, otherwise it will make a new one. “Delete” will delete an existing interview if present, and fail if the person does not have one. In the case of “Delete”, if more than one is present, IFI will work with the one which matches the type specified, and if more than one of that type exists, it will attempt to match on date as well.

Lists

Action 1, Action 2, etc. can hold “Add”, “a”, “Delete”, or “d”. These fields are not case-sensitive, and indicate what IFI should do to the current person for this list. For each list, if an action is not specified, it is assumed to be “add”. Note: you obviously cannot add or remove people in Intellilists from here.

People

Action can hold “Create”, “C”, “Update”, “U”, “Delete”, or “d”. These fields are not case-sensitive, and indicate what IFI should do for this person. Specifying “Create” will always make a new person with this data, unless the person already exists, in which case it will fail. “Update” will only update an existing person, and fail if the person does not exist. “Delete” will delete an existing person if present, and fail if the person does not exist.

“Delete” is very dangerous! It deletes the person and all of his information, including certifications, custom fields, letters, volunteer hours, and others with no further prompting.

Project people

Action can hold “Add”, “A”, “Edit”, “E”, “Edit/add”, “*”, “Delete”, or “d”. These fields are not case-sensitive, and indicate what IFI should do for this person. Specifying “Add” will always add this person, unless the person already exists or cannot be registered, in which case it will fail. “Edit” will only update an existing person, and fail if the person is not registered. “Edit/add” will edit the person if registered, or add if not. “Delete” will delete an existing person from the project, and fail if the person does not exist. “Delete” does not delete the person himself, just his registration from this project.

When editing an existing person, you can change the person’s role and/or delegation. Use the “New role” and/or “New delegation” fields for this. When adding or deleting a person, these fields are ignored.

Volunteer assignments

When importing new records here, if IFI finds a job slot which corresponds to the data provided, it will put the person into that job slot, otherwise a non-slot assignment is created, one which contains only as much information as you enter. Note: IFI will not let you create a job assignment which conflicts with any other assignments the person may already have in this project. If you’re deleting an assignment, only the start date/time and delegation need to be provided. If "Job" is provided, any "Job group" value provided is ignored. Instead VSys gets the job group from the job itself.
